The governance engine
Every change is a governed, audited transaction
Most HR apps let you edit records in place. HRMSTONE doesn't. Every change — a raise, a transfer, a leave request, a loan — is a typed transaction that moves along two independent axes: a workflow status and a posting status. Posted is immutable; corrections are reversing or retroactive entries, never silent edits.
Two-axis lifecycle
Workflow (Draft → Pending → Approved) × posting (Unposted → Posted). Posted = locked, accounting-style.
Approval engine
Ordered steps, committees, delegation, consultation and SLA escalation — segregation of duties by design.
Effective-dated & retroactive
Back-date a change and the engine computes the exact delta as arrears — it never corrupts history.
Provable & audited
Per-line calculation logs explain every number; an immutable trail records who did what, when.

MENA & GCC statutory, built in
Statutory-accurate pay in every market you operate
Each jurisdiction is a versioned, effective-dated country pack — so a law change next year never rewrites last year, and the figures published always match the figures paid.
End-of-service gratuity
Tiered accrual slices (e.g. 21 days/yr for years 1–5, 30 after), average-salary basis and per-country base components.
Social security & filing
Employee/employer contribution engines with ceilings, plus authority batch filing — GOSI, GPSSA, ETA.
Residence & visa lifecycle
Iqama/residence renewal, exit/re-entry, dependents and air-ticket entitlement, with expiry-driven alerts.
Wage protection & GL
WPS-format bank files for KSA/UAE and journal vouchers that bridge straight into your finance system.
Tax engines
Bracket/exemption engines as a calc-pipeline stage — PAYE for the Levant, disabled where there's no income tax.
Versioned country packs
Concurrently active, effective-dated config — adding a jurisdiction is data, never a fork.

Enterprise localization
Five locale axes — resolved independently
Localization isn't "translate the buttons." A user in Riyadh can read English, see Hijri dates, format in SAR, on Riyadh time, under KSA rules — all at once. HRMSTONE models each axis separately and resolves it per user.

Per-user preferences
Each person chooses their language, calendar, timezone, digits and theme — and their own payslip renders that way.
Hijri ⇄ Gregorian
Switch calendars as a reversible display conversion over a UTC instant; dual-display and legal-output locks supported.
Currency-correct money
JOD, KWD, BHD and OMR carry 3 decimals — a Money type uses currency-driven precision so payroll never silently rounds wrong.
Digit shaping
Eastern-Arabic ٠١٢٣ or Western 0123, per context — Arabic UI often keeps Western digits for money and IDs.
True RTL mirroring
Full layout mirroring via CSS logical properties, mirrored directional icons and bidi-isolated mixed content.
Bilingual documents
Letters, payslips and notifications render in the recipient's locale — Arabic + English side-by-side where required.

Deployment & data sovereignty
One codebase. Deployed on your terms.
From managed SaaS to a fully air-gapped install — the same product, with the control posture banks and governments require.
Managed SaaS
We host and operate it, multi-tenant. Every workspace gets its own isolated database; tenancy is resolved from the token and fails closed.
- Per-tenant database isolation
- Region-pinned for residency
- JIT, consented break-glass support
BYO-Database + your keys
Bring your own PostgreSQL and customer-managed keys. We run the app; you hold the encryption key — revoke it and access stops instantly.
- Customer-managed keys (BYOK/CMK)
- Envelope-encrypted PII
- Revocable kill-switch
On-prem / air-gapped
Host the entire stack in your data center, single-tenant. Zero standing vendor access; support is escorted and customer-recorded.
- Signed, air-gap release bundles
- Zero standing vendor access
- You own keys, backups & restore
